Bristol Bridges is a 46.6-mile loop route in United Kingdom. Bristol is believed to be the first city in the world to solve the 300 year old Konigsberg Bridge Problem, determining whether it is possible to cross every bridge in a city only once, starting and finishing at the same spot.
